Units required for this degree
A minimum of 120 units is required for this degree.
Additional units will be required to complete this degree
if a student:
A) is admitted to the UA with deficiencies;
B) changes his/her academic program;
C) fails to meet minimum course/program requirements; or
D) ineffectively plans or fails to execute a course of
study that leads directly to degree completion.
E) is completing more than one baccalaureate degree.
--> NEEDS:120.00 UNITS
1) A maximum of 64 units of community college course work
may apply toward graduation.
2) A maximum of 60 units of correspondence credit and/or
credit by exam may apply toward graduation.
3) A maximum of 15 units completed as a non-degree seeking
student may be used for fulfilling undergraduate degree
requirements.
4) A minimum of 30 units of UA University Credit
(excluding correspondence credit and credit by exam)
is required.
5) A minimum of 18 of the final 30 units taken toward
degree requirements must be UA University Credit.

Philosophy Major
The Philosophy Major requires a minimum of 30 units
including at least 15 upper-division units and 15 units
taken in residence at the UA.
--> NEEDS: 30.00 UNITS
-----------------------------------------------------------------
Philosophy Major - Core Courses
- 1) PHIL202 and PHIL344 are required for the Philosophy
Major. It is recommended that PHIL202 be taken before
PHIL344.

Philosophy Major - History Areas
Complete a total of 2 History of Philosophy courses from
at least 2 of the following categories:
- 1) History of Ancient Philosophy - select 1 course from:
SELECT FROM: GRK 412 PHIL 260 ,470 ,472A,472B
- 2) History of Medieval Philosophy
SELECT FROM: PHIL 261
- 3) History of Modern Philosophy - select 1 course from:
SELECT FROM: PHIL 262 ,263 ,410A,410B,471A,471B
